Can Fourier transform be used for non-periodic signal?

Fourier series is defined for periodic signals and the Fourier transform can be applied to aperiodic (occurring without periodicity) signals.

Can a non-periodic function Fourier series?

Fourier series can only represent functions that are periodic. However, non-periodic functions can be handled using an extension of the Fourier Series called the Fourier transform which treats non-periodic functions as periodic with infinite period.

Is Fourier transform always periodic?

It is worth noting that the discrete time Fourier transform is always 2π periodic, while this is not the case for the continuous time Fourier transform. Also, both the continuous time and discrete time Fourier transforms are defined in the frequency domain, which is a continuous domain.
